Community Projects

world-connect-people-community-international

Houston Asian Jaycees  is one of the most active chapter in Texas in term of helping community with various projects that benefit Houston Community and foreign countries who suffer disasters.  Our chapter get together  more than 2 times  each month to work as team for the community projects  depend on the needs and types of events . These are list of  2009 and current projects we have been involved :

1. Food for senior

2. Fund-raising projects for disaster relief such as Katrina support ,   Galveston relief, Taiwanese Bowling fund-raising, Haiti fund, …

3. Food serving for Homeless shelters, Women shelters, Wheel on Meals, and others

4. Nursing home visit

5.  Support the troop by sending thank-you cards, and organizing fund-raising fund.

6. Relief for Life

7. Christmas gifts for needy children

8. School Supply Drive

9. Blood Drive

10. Others
